Output 319c759463b30abc660ab0c83e6c01e6d2038969317c961e7cea6afbd4f2840b:0

value
667500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ec43e0f25d140d00c25704944349bd88e73a21bf OP_EQUAL
address
3PEGi7MX3UVyNeewJdjWTiBebnVHrYLSfS
transaction
319c759463b30abc660ab0c83e6c01e6d2038969317c961e7cea6afbd4f2840b
spent
true